Liberia entry requirements for Bosnia and Herzegovina passport holders
Bosnia and Herzegovina passport holders need a visa to enter Liberia. You must arrange this before you travel — there is no visa-on-arrival option. Plan ahead, as processing can take several weeks.
Entry requirements
| Requirement | Details | Status |
|---|---|---|
| Visa application Visa required | You need a visa before traveling to Liberia. Apply through the Liberia Immigration Service website or at the nearest Liberian embassy. Processing times vary — start at least 4 weeks before your trip.Apply for visa | Required |
| Valid passport Must be valid for at least 6 months beyond departure | Your passport must have at least 6 months of validity remaining from your departure date from Liberia. Airlines check this before boarding — if your passport expires sooner, you'll be denied boarding. | Required |
| Return or onward ticket Required for entry | Immigration officers at Roberts International Airport will ask to see a confirmed return or onward ticket. Without one, you may be refused entry and sent back on the next flight. | Required |
| Proof of accommodation Recommended to carry | Have a hotel booking or invitation letter ready. Immigration may ask where you're staying — a printed booking confirmation avoids delays. | Recommended |
| Proof of funds Recommended to carry | Carry enough cash (USD is widely accepted) or a bank statement showing you can support yourself during your stay. Immigration may ask how you'll fund your trip. | Recommended |

| Service | Cost |
|---|---|
| Tourist visa (single entry)Required for Bosnia and Herzegovina passport holders; apply at Liberian embassy. | ~$100 USD (exact amount varies by embassy) |
| Tourist visa (multiple entry)Allows multiple entries; valid for up to 1 year. | ~$150 USD (exact amount varies by embassy) |
| Stay extension feePossible at immigration office; subject to approval. | ~$50 USD (estimated) |
| Overstay fine per dayPenalty for overstaying visa validity; pay at immigration before departure. | ~$20 USD per day (estimated, max cap unknown) |

Transiting through Liberia
Bosnia and Herzegovina passport holders need a transit visa to change planes in Liberia, even if staying airside.
